Tiivistelmä:This article explores a model (MIKADO) to analyzes scenarios for the reduction of the environmental impact of an aluminium die casting plant. Based on that Neto, B., Kroeze, C., Hordijk, L., Costa, C., 2008. Modelling the environmental impact of an aluminium pressure die casting company and options for control and Environmental modelling & software 23 (2) 147–168. It is includes the model description and explored the model by applying it to a plant in which no reduction options are assumed to be implemented. The author performs a systematic analysis of reduction options: 1) Seven types of reduction strategies, assuming the simultaneous implementation of different reduction options. 2) These strategies are analyzed with respect to their potential to reduce emissions, environmental impact and costs associated with the implementation of options. It is found to differ largely in their potential to reduce the environmental impact of the plant (10–87%), as well as in the costs associated with the implementation of options (−268 to +277 k€/year) and argues able to define 11 strategies, reducing the overall environmental impact by more than 50%. Of these, two have net negative costs, indicating that the company may in fact earn money through their implementation.
